如何使用CSS3创建圆角
使用CSS3创建圆角
摘要:CSS3中的圆角属性是非常常用的一种属性,可以用来美化不同的网页元素。本文将详细介绍如何使用CSS3创建圆角,并从四个方面进行探讨:基础知识、语法格式、示例与应用。
一、基础知识
CSS3的圆角属性可以用来改变元素的边框来使它们更圆滑美观。通过简单设置border-radius属性,可以在任意盒子的四个角上制作出圆角效果。其中,border-radius有以下几个参数:
1. border-radius:10px; /* 四个角上的半径都设置为10像素 */
2. border-radius:10px 20px; /* 左上和右下的角设置为10像素,右上和左下的角设置为20像素 */
3. border-radius:10px 20px 30px; /* 左上角设置为10像素,右上角设置为20像素,右下角设置为30像素,左下角默认设置为20像素 */
二、语法格式
border-radius属性可以用于多个CSS样式中,例如你可以在 div 中使用它,也可以在 a 元素中使用它。
实例:
1. 设置所有四个边角的半径为10px:
div {
border-radius: 10px;
2. 设置不同位置的边角的半径:
div {
border-top-left-radius: 10px;
border-top-right-radius: 20px;
border-bottom-right-radius: 30px;
border-bottom-left-radius: 40px;
3. 设置半径非常大的圆角:
div {
border-radius: 50%;
三、示例与应用
1. 圆形头像
2. 圆角按钮
3. 梯形
四、如何避免圆角的不适宜
虽然圆角属性在美化网页设计中被广泛使用,但是在某些情况下,圆角可能会导致网站排版混乱,需要我们特别注意。例如,在使用CSS3的box-shadow、transform等属性创建具有3D效果的元素时,为了保持它们的立体感,我们应该尽可能的使用直角而非圆角。
五、总结
使用CSS3创建圆角无疑是一种非常有用的技巧,可以使网页看起来更加美观。本文从基础知识、语法格式、示例与应用等四个方面进行了探讨。当然,在使用圆角属性时,还需要注意避免不适宜的情况出现。希望本文能够为读者提供帮助,让他们能够更好地掌握这一技巧。
如发现本站有涉嫌抄袭侵权/违法违规等内容,请<举报!一经查实,本站将立刻删除。